How to battle fleas and get rid of them without cost
Fleas are pesty blood-sucking insects that infest your property if your animal is infected. They live on the animal and spread to the carpets or couch where the animal rests. They bite people causing minor swelling.
To rid the house of these pesky invaders, fill several shallow bowls or plates with cold water and place them on the floor of the infected areas. Do this at night before bedtime and in the morning the bowls will be full of dead fleas, they find the water because of thirst then drown in it. Follow this procedure until problem has been rectified.
Always buy a flea-collar for your pet and you won't have this problem! They're inexpensive and worth the prevention of fleas.
